循环创建字典键的方法

在Python中,我们经常需要创建字典并向其中添加键值对。有时候我们需要使用循环来动态地创建字典的键,这样可以节省时间和代码量。本文将介绍如何使用循环来创建字典的键,并附有代码示例。

创建字典并添加键值对

在Python中,字典是一种无序的数据结构,其中的元素是以键值对的形式存储的。要创建一个字典并向其中添加键值对,可以使用以下语法:

# 创建一个空字典
my_dict = {}

# 向字典中添加键值对
my_dict['key1'] = 'value1'
my_dict['key2'] = 'value2'

以上示例中,我们创建了一个空字典my_dict,并向其中添加了两个键值对。如果需要添加多个键值对,可以一一使用赋值语句添加。

使用循环创建字典的键

有时候我们需要根据一组数据动态地创建字典的键,这时就可以使用循环来实现。下面是一个使用循环创建字典键的示例:

# 创建一个空字典
my_dict = {}

# 定义一个列表作为键的数据源
keys = ['key1', 'key2', 'key3']

# 使用循环向字典中添加键值对
for key in keys:
    my_dict[key] = None

print(my_dict)

在上面的示例中,我们定义了一个列表keys作为键的数据源,然后使用循环遍历该列表,将每个元素作为字典的键添加到my_dict中。这样就实现了动态地创建字典的键。

旅行图

journey
    title My Travel Journey
    section Start
    Start --> Explore: Begin Exploration
    section Explore
    Explore --> Adventure: Go on an Adventure
    Adventure --> Discover: Discover New Places
    Discover --> End: End of Journey
    section End

关系图

erDiagram
    CUSTOMER ||--o| ORDER : places
    ORDER ||--| PRODUCT : contains
    CUSTOMER {
        int id
        string name
        string email
    }
    ORDER {
        int id
        int total
    }
    PRODUCT {
        int id
        string name
        int price
    }

通过以上示例,你可以学习到如何使用循环来创建字典的键,并且掌握了使用字典的基本方法。希望本文对你有所帮助,谢谢阅读!

结尾

在Python中,使用循环创建字典的键是一种非常常见的操作,尤其在处理大量数据时更为实用。通过灵活运用循环和字典,我们可以更加高效地管理和操作数据。希望本文的内容能够帮助你更好地理解如何使用循环创建字典的键。如果有任何疑问或建议,欢迎在评论区留言交流讨论。祝你编程愉快!